Smoking Pig BBQ, a beloved barbecue joint in North Las Vegas, has reopened under new management and is undergoing a comprehensive makeover. Located at 4379 N Las Vegas Blvd, the restaurant remains open throughout the renovation process, ensuring regulars can still enjoy their favorite brisket, ribs, and pulled pork without interruption.
The core offering remains unchanged: barbecue smoked low and slow, with every cut of meat spending hours over smoke until tender and flavorful. This commitment to quality has earned Smoking Pig its reputation as North Las Vegas's go-to destination for authentic barbecue. Fans can also find the same menu at sister locations in Fremont and San Jose, California, extending the brand's reach along the West Coast.
Under the new management, the restaurant is being refreshed from the ground up. The upcoming changes include a reopened bar with cold drinks, televisions tuned to sports, and a redesigned dining room intended to become a neighborhood gathering spot. Additionally, dedicated military nights will honor personnel from nearby Nellis Air Force Base, and family nights will make it easier for local families to dine together.
Smoking Pig BBQ continues to offer catering for weddings, birthdays, graduations, corporate lunches, and tailgates, handling events of all sizes across the valley. For convenience, the restaurant provides a drive-thru and delivery service, ensuring customers can access their barbecue fix quickly, whether on the go or at home.
